HP doesn't do BoA. What competitions do they attend?

Highland Park won the Midlothian Marching Contest and the Mansfield Preview Marching Contest. They also finished first in the AREA C Prelims and won the Area C 5A Marching Championships. Do not expect them to move up to 6A. Highland Park always tends to come in under the 5A enrollment limit. They have a very well funded Band Program.

I think the 3 NEISD Bands that routinely do BOA competitions will be looking for a big year in 2020

 

Reagan - big year with their first BOA SA Gold and rumored to possibly make a run at Grand Nats next year

CTJ - always a fun program that does their style of show even during a state year - after 8 top 5 and 2 golds at BOA SA - I see them coming back strong in 2020 and it will be interesting to see what they come up with - something different I am sure.

Churchill - Bronze medal in McAllen tied for 2nd and only a point away from gold - did not compete in Austin or SA as they normally do - I believe their director is in her first year there - will be interesting to see them come back - they had a long history of always making finals in BOA regionals 

 

the other 4 schools in the district do not do much more than BOA-SA because it is local.
